doorpanels-300x200.jpgPatio Door Locks Repair

The locks on your patio doors are essential to your home's security. If they're not functioning properly, you can put your family and possessions at risk.

It's easy to fix problems with the patio door lock by following a few easy steps. This fast fix involves lubricating and cleaning the lock.

Inspect the Lock

Patio doors are an essential security feature. They need to be strong enough to withstand the elements and keep burglars at bay. Wear and tear, extreme temperatures and dust can cause the frame, hinges, and locking mechanisms to fail. It's best to be proactive in addressing these issues and to regularly inspect your sliding door locks for signs of damage and to make the necessary repairs.

Some of the most common problems with patio door locks is difficulties locking or unlocking them, a latch that is stuck and keys that do not rotate smoothly. You may need to adjust the mechanism of your lock or tighten screws based on the issue you're experiencing.

If your patio door lock is stuck in an open position and you cannot open it Try using a flat head or credit card. If none of these methods work, contact a professional locksmith who repairs sliding patio doors will help you open the door lock without damaging the frame.

Sliding uPVC local patio door repairs doors are usually fitted with a mortise lock which utilizes a handle and locking cylinder to secure the lock. The locks are safe however they can break or bend under the weight of an open patio door that is slammed. It's a good idea to examine the mortise lock and handle for signs of wear, like bends or scratches, before it is broken and you must replace it.

It's an excellent idea to identify the size and position of the current lock by taking a photograph with your digital camera. This will help you communicate these details to a supplier when you're seeking a replacement lock. This will ensure you get the right lock for your door and is compatible with the current mounting setup. Otherwise, you'll have an issue installing a new lock that isn't compatible with the existing hardware. This could cause further issues later on.

Clean the Lock

Patio doors are the most common entry point into a home, and are therefore an ideal target for burglars. Therefore, it's essential that the locks on your patio doors are functional and conform to Police & Insurance standards.

Fortunately, there are some simple steps you can take to handle the lock that is refusing to cooperate. If you have to re-align the patio door and clean the lock or even replace it, these four simple steps will ensure that your doors are operating correctly and provide the level of security you expect.

The first thing you must do is give the lock a good clean using hot soapy water and a damp cloth. You want to wipe away any stains or dirt that may have accumulated on the lock. Once you've done this then you can use a dry cloth to remove any excess water and allow the lock to air-dry completely before attempting to insert it again.

Then, you must lubricate your lock. This is especially important for doors made of uPVC, which can become extremely squeaky over time. You can use a spray oil lubricant, such as WD40 or petroleum jelly to lubricate the keyways and internal mechanisms. After applying the lubricant to your key, clean it off to prevent spreading any dirt that might have been accumulated.

Once your uPVC aluminium patio door repairs doors are cleaned and lubricated, you should then test them. Observe whether the door is moving in and out of the frame with ease. Also, make sure that the hinges and locking points are aligned properly with the frame of the door. You will notice alignment marks along the edges of the frame. It is easy to fix the problem by re-aligning the doors with the frame.

It's also worth noting that various types of uPVC door locks are available. You might need to replace your lock if it is damaged or broken. If you own E2011 patio doors locks, you will need to replace them to ensure that you are safe by using the E2469 and E2487 lock assembly. These assemblies are made up of three components, including an E2014 mortise lock, an escutcheon, and a lock hasp.

Lubricate the Lock

For the majority of patio doors, the lock mechanism is located inside the door, hidden from the view. If your key cylinder is wearing out or you simply want to upgrade the lock for greater security, you can buy the replacement kit at most locksmiths or home improvement stores. These kits cost between $10 and $20, and come with tools for opening the lock and an extra cylinder. Follow the instructions in your kit for disassembling and cleaning your old lock. Then install the new lock. Depending on how securely the key cylinder fits in the hole of the lock, you may need to adjust it slightly for proper operation.

Dry graphite powder is used to lubricate locks. It is an inexpensive and popular alternative to liquid lubricants which attract dust and clog the mechanism. It is available at hardware stores or model train shops, as well as some office supply stores. If you decide to use it, make sure the dry graphite chunk is free of tiny pieces of wood stuck to it. You can also purchase commercial graphite spray. When the spray is applied to the lock, the solvent in the spray evaporates, leaving behind a layer of dry graphite which locks without attracting dust or accumulating moisture.

Replacement-Windows-150x150.jpgYou can also add lubrication to your lock by putting some WD-40 sprays directly into the keyway. Then, push your key in and out several times to spread the lubricant throughout the lock. After a few minutes, try the key again and check if it turns easily. If your key still sticks then try the lock again within a few days after the WD-40 has been allowed to dry.

Most homeowners can easily change their patio door locks, but if the sliding patio door repairs door has an invisible latch or deadbolt lock that is built-in the door, the process might be more complicated. If your patio door is equipped with an invisible latch, it's necessary to remove the decorative interior cover by taking off the screws that hold it in place. If your patio door is fitted with a deadbolt it is necessary to take off the bolt. After removing the deadbolt and the knob assembly, you are able to install the new lock.

Replace the Lock

Patio doors are an important part of your home's security and it's common for them to occasionally malfunction. There are times when debris can get stuck in the mechanism of the lock, or it could simply wear out over time. In either case, a damaged patio door latch poses an extremely risk to the security of your home. Regularly inspecting your patio door locks can help keep them in good shape and let you easily solve any issues that occur.

If the lubrication of your lock doesn't solve the problem then it's time to replace it. This is an easy task that most homeowners can complete by themselves, but it is important to follow the instructions to ensure that the new lock will work with your current system. You can also bring your old lock to the store to assist you locate a replacement.

The first step to replace the lock on a patio door is to remove the handle. This can be accomplished by unscrewing screws that secure the handle. After the handle has been removed, you will be able to remove the screws that secure the lock body to the jamb of the door.

After the screws have been removed after which you can lift the latch lever out of the door frame. Secure the latch lever using a graphite pen. It will fall into frame if not secured. Next, remove the door strike. The hole in which the lock hook is located when the patio door closes will be exposed. Once the old door strike is removed you can install the new one into place.

It is crucial to use screws with longer lengths when replacing the door strike. They are used to secure it to the frame. Verify that the new strike is in alignment with the opening of the door frame, and then tighten them both.

There are a variety of locks for patio doors. The most commonly used is the central rail key-operated locking system. They secure the door to the frame in multiple points and, once the key is inserted, all points must be locked. These locks offer a higher level of security than basic locking systems and can often result in discounts on your homeowner's insurance.
